Navigating Legal Formalities and Customs & Regulations
When it comes to international trade, understanding and complying with legal formalities, customs, and regulations are crucial for a smooth and successful operation. Navigating through the complex web of rules and requirements can be daunting, but with the right knowledge and preparation, businesses can avoid costly delays and penalties. Here are some key points to consider:
Legal Formalities
1. Import/Export Laws: Familiarize yourself with the import and export laws of the countries you are dealing with. Make sure your products comply with all relevant regulations and standards.
2. Documentation: Ensure all necessary documentation, such as invoices, packing lists, and certificates of origin, are in order and accurate. Any errors or missing documents can lead to customs delays.
3. Tariffs and Taxes: Understand the tariffs and taxes applicable to your products. Be aware of any preferential trade agreements that could lower your duty costs.
Customs & Regulations
1. Customs Clearance: Work with a reliable customs broker to facilitate smooth customs clearance. They can help navigate complex procedures and ensure compliance with regulations.
2. Restricted and Prohibited Goods: Be aware of any restrictions or prohibitions on certain goods. Avoid shipping items that are banned or restricted in the destination country.
3. Trade Compliance: Stay updated on trade compliance regulations to avoid violations. Penalties for non-compliance can be severe, including fines and shipment seizures.
